The jackpot in the Channel Islands Christmas Lottery has finally been claimed.
The winner came forward in Guernsey and has pocketed £977,184.
They want to remain anonymous.
A number checker has been put on the gov.je website to make it easier see to if you have won one of the smaller prizes.
Proceeds from the annual festive draw are distributed to local charities.
